WASHINGTON, May 2 -- Sen. Steve Daines, R-Montana, issued the following news release on May 1:
U.S. Senator Steve Daines announced that the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services will be directing $199,485,740 to support 121 rural healthcare providers in Montana during the ongoing Coronavirus pandemic.
